Does the age you are in affect the speed at which your workers can build improvements? I have noticed in the game I am playing that my workers have begun building various improvements more quickly than they did a few turns ago. I have not changed government or done anything else that would account for this increase in worker speed.

inventing replaceable parts increases worker speed.

EDIT:

I beleive the industrial age has one such reserch topic. Steam Power, Replaceable Parts, or industrialization.

Only replaceable parts.
 
Does the age you are in affect the speed at which your workers can build improvements?...
No. Reaching Replaceable Parts causes workers to work twice as fast!

Getting to RP is, IMO, the most important point for Histographic Victory games. (And, you get to use Civil Engineers.) ;)

Firstly I'd like to confirm D0MINATRIX's answer on when traties come up for renegotiation. If you don't want to have to redeclare or be forced to accept peace for a further 20 turns, don't have a gpt trade as part of the deal.

Russia's real strength does not lie with cossacks in either C3C or vanilla. Their UU comes far too late for a conquest/domination victory. Their main strength as far as HOF games are concerned is the ability to get through the tech tree fast, by popping techs in the AA and cheap libraries to aid reseach beyond this. SirPleb's 210AD Diplomatic victory demontrates why this is so.
